The USA is home to 1,641 game development studios and publishers, figures from a new report by the Entertainment Software Association show.
According to the research, these companies operate 1,871 separate video game facilities across the country.
California is home to by far the most game companies in the USA, with 546 setting up shop in the state. 196 companies are based in Texas, 154 in New York, 149 in Washington and 92 in Massachusetts.
406 colleges and universities across 46 states also offer graduate and undergraduate degrees and professional certificates in game design and development. This represents an increase from 390 last year.
California offers the most games-related courses, with 66 schools providing video game-related programmes. A study by the Higher Education Video Game Alliance claims that 93 per cent of alumni have gained employment within a year after graduating, earning around $76,200 on average a year.
